Output 95590b4b3ae6850342b98db97a607cb3077ed4ba13e2477b35f2ff718683c409:1

value
285388128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f8d26fe2b0eb460ea172c7c1fed0f511a3dc26 OP_EQUAL
address
MMUrKH5oxfkyZAV8jgKG6mc79WRuuWnMBv
transaction
95590b4b3ae6850342b98db97a607cb3077ed4ba13e2477b35f2ff718683c409
spent
true